About Nghĩa Lộ Time Zone
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am uses Asia/Bangkok, which places it on UTC+7 all year. That means the city stays on the same clock format throughout the year and does not shift for daylight saving time, which makes planning recurring meetings simpler for businesses, schools, and travel itineraries.
This time zone is shared across much of mainland Southeast Asia, so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am stays aligned with key regional markets and transportation schedules in the same offset band. For teams working with nearby cities in Vietnam or with partners in Thailand and parts of Indochina, the fixed UTC+7 schedule avoids the seasonal confusion that affects North America, Europe, and Australia.
Because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am does not observe daylight saving time, its relationship with cities like New York, London, and Sydney changes depending on the season in those locations. That matters for cross-border operations in industries such as software outsourcing, tourism, logistics, and export coordination, where a morning in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am may be a late evening or overnight slot elsewhere.
Nghĩa Lộ City Details
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am has a population of 68,206, making it a smaller urban center with practical regional importance in northern Vietnam. Its coordinates are 21.6°, 104.51667°, placing it inland in the northwest part of the country, where road travel and regional coordination often matter more than direct international flight timing.
The local currency is the VND, and the country dialing code is +84. Those details matter for business travel, hotel bookings, supplier invoicing, and phone coordination when arranging meetings with local offices or family contacts in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am.
Time Differences from Nghĩa Lộ
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is on UTC+7, so it sits ahead of several major business centers and behind a few Asia-Pacific cities. This makes it a useful midpoint for regional coordination, especially when working with teams in Southeast Asia, Japan, Australia, Europe, and the United States.
In January,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 12 hours ahead of New York (UTC-5):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 9:00 PM the previous day in New York. In July,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 11 hours ahead of New York (UTC-4):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 10:00 PM the previous day in New York. That gap is important for US sales calls, customer support handoffs, and overnight incident response.
In January,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 7 hours ahead of London (UTC+0):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 2:00 AM in London. In July,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 6 hours ahead of London (UTC+1):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 3:00 AM in London. For UK teams, that usually means early-morning or late-afternoon windows are better than midday meetings in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am.
In January,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 2 hours behind Tokyo (UTC+9):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 11:00 AM in Tokyo. In July,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 2 hours behind Tokyo (UTC+9):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 11:00 AM in Tokyo. This stable gap is convenient for Japan-Vietnam business, because the offset does not change between seasons.
In January,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 4 hours behind Sydney (UTC+11):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 1:00 PM in Sydney. In July,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 3 hours behind Sydney (UTC+10):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 12:00 PM in Sydney. That makes Sydney coordination easier around Vietnam morning hours, especially for education, travel, and APAC project meetings.
In January,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 3 hours ahead of Dubai (UTC+4):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 6:00 AM in Dubai. In July, Nghĩa Lộ, Vietnam is 3 hours ahead of Dubai (UTC+4): when it is 9:00 AM in Nghĩa Lộ, it is 6:00 AM in Dubai. This steady difference is useful for trade, freight, and supplier coordination because the gap does not change by season.
